What You'll Do

As a Clinic Director, you will oversee the daily operations of our clinic and lead a dedicated team of BCBAs and RBTs. You will provide both clinical oversight and leadership, maintain a manageable caseload, and drive key performance and quality metrics that directly impact client outcomes and team success.

Day-to-Day Responsibilities Include:

  • Lead clinic operations to ensure high-quality service delivery

  • Provide clinical supervision and support to BCBAs and RBTs

  • Maintain a small direct caseload (6–20 billable hours depending on clinic maturity)

  • Collaborate with admissions, scheduling, billing, HR, and recruiting teams

  • Analyze client cancellations and implement proactive solutions

  • Support timely assessments, treatment plans, and transitions into care

  • Conduct team meetings, performance evaluations, and provide ongoing feedback

  • Align hiring with caseload needs and manage retention strategies

What We’re Looking For

Please apply only if you meet the following minimum requirements:

  • Master’s degree in ABA, Psychology, or related field

  • Active BCBA certification and eligible for LBA in Utah (if applicable)

  • Minimum of 3years of clinical ABA experience , including 1 year of leadership or supervisory specific roles in the field of ABA or a related field.

  • Strong communication, organizational, and team leadership skills

  • A commitment to compassionate, family-centered care
